Technical Specifications to Verify

Material composition is the primary technical differentiator, with brushes constructed from ABS+PC alloys, PP, or nylon wire offering distinct durability profiles. For automotive applications, the handle material, often plastic or ABS+PC, must provide a secure grip and resistance to chemical cleaners, while the bristle material determines the scrubbing intensity. Buyers must verify if the brush is designed for car bodies specifically or if it serves broader industrial purposes, as the latter may require harder materials like silicon carbide that could damage vehicle paint.

What materials are used for multi purpose car cleaning brushes?

These brushes typically utilize ABS+PC alloy or plastic handles combined with nylon bristles. Some industrial variants incorporate silicon carbide for heavy-duty applications. The combination of durable plastic and synthetic fibers ensures effective cleaning without damaging surfaces like car bodies or glass.
